Core Viewpoint - The UK, France, and Germany are calling for an immediate end to the humanitarian disaster in Gaza, urging Israel to lift restrictions on humanitarian aid and facilitate effective operations by the UN and NGOs to address the looming famine threat [1] Group 1 - The three countries emphasize the need for an immediate ceasefire and the swift conclusion of hostilities, while also demanding Hamas to unconditionally release all individuals detained since October 7, 2023, and to disarm and withdraw from Gaza [1] - The statement explicitly opposes any actions that impose Israeli sovereignty over occupied Palestinian territories, highlighting that threats of annexation, settlement construction, and violence against Palestinians undermine peace efforts [1] - The UK, France, and Germany commit to collaborating with international partners, including the UN, to develop a clear and feasible plan for the next phase in Gaza, ensuring large-scale humanitarian aid delivery [1] Group 2 - Since October 6, indirect negotiations between Hamas and Israel have been taking place in Doha, Qatar, aiming for a 60-day ceasefire agreement [1] - On October 24, following Hamas's response to the ceasefire proposal, Israel recalled its negotiation team, leading to a temporary halt in talks [1]
